School uniforms are unlike any other business in the clothing industry. Street clothing retailers such as Land's End, JC Penney, or Gap limit what kind of clothing you can buy. When you walk into one of their stores, what you see is what you get. School uniform supply companies are different. When your school partners with Hall Closet Uniforms & Apparel, your options are endless. Your school has the ability to create a school uniform using any combination of styles, colors, cuts or fabric that you want.
This is a great advantage to your school. You can create a look that matches your ideals perfectly. It is this flexibility that sets school uniforms apart from the rest of the clothing industry. Of course, you're probably asking yourself, "If the school uniform industry can offer so many options, why isn't everyone doing it?" The answer is that it is more complicated. When we stock inventory at Hall Closet, we're stocking in order to be flexible, not only for your school, but for each school that we work with.
This leaves us with a lot of items to keep in stock. For pants alone there is plain front, pleated front, relaxed fit, classic fit, and elastic back. Each of these has lengths of 30, 32 and 34 multiplied by all of the various waist sizes. While we order these things, we are trying to anticipate what sizes and styles the students from your school will need. Over the years, we have become very accomplished at this, but there is still a level of uncertainty.
So when it comes to the question, "How do I get the most out of my school uniform supply company?" We answer, "It's best to order early!" Its not that we don't stock the styles and sizes that your school needs. It's just that we know flexibility is important to your school, and unlike the rest of the clothing industry, we're going to give you all the options. But while the rest of the clothing industry can keep higher levels of inventory, our wider selection of items forces us to keep lower levels of inventory.
Because of this, it is an industry standard for parents whose schools partner with school uniform supply companies to order no later than July 31st, whether you're working with Hall Closet, or any other supplier. We tell our partner school families to start ordering as early as June. This allows time for school uniform supply companies to gauge levels of inventory, and to order more stock if certain items run low. If by chance a popular item does go on backorder, there is still time to get it out to you before school starts. In this way, we can be flexible, and you can get what you want, when you need it.
